📄 edit_testuc.asp
字号:
cTreeNodeName = Trim(Rs("fchrTreeNodeName"))
else
End If
Set Rs = Nothing
'查询结果集
MySql = "Select PC.*,SU.fchrRealName as CreateUserName,SU1.fchrRealName as AuditUserName,SU1.fchrRealName as LastModifyUserName,PC1.fchrCaseName as VersionSourceName From Project1_CaseMain PC Left Outer Join Sys_User SU ON PC.fchrCreateUserID=SU.fchrUserID Left Outer Join Project1_CaseMain PC1 ON PC.fchrVersionSourceID=PC1.fchrCaseMainID Left Outer Join Sys_User SU1 ON PC.fchrAuditUserID=SU1.fchrUserID Left Outer Join Sys_User SU2 ON PC.fchrLastModifyUserID=SU2.fchrUserID Where REPLACE(REPLACE(REPLACE(PC.fchrCaseMainID, '}', ''), '{', ''), '-', '_')= '"+cCaseMainID+"'"
Set Rs = Conn.Execute(MySql)
If NOT Rs.EOF Then '读取用例详细信息
'cCaseMainID= Trim(Rs("fchrCaseMainID"))
cCaseMainCode= Trim(Rs("fchrCaseMainCode"))
cCaseName= Trim(Rs("fchrCaseName"))
cAuditState= Trim(Rs("ftinAuditState"))
cTestProgressID= Trim(Rs("fchrTestProgressID"))
cDealPriorityID= Trim(Rs("fchrDealPriorityID"))
cTestDesc= Trim(Rs("fchrTestDesc"))
cEntironment= Trim(Rs("fchrEntironment"))
cFileURL= Trim(Rs("fchrFileURL"))
cScriptURL= Trim(Rs("fchrScriptURL"))
cCreateUserID= Trim(Rs("fchrCreateUserID"))
cCreateUserName= Trim(Rs("CreateUserName"))
cCreatedate= Trim(Rs("fdtmCreatedate"))
cAuditUserID=Trim(Rs("fchrAuditUserID"))
cAuditUserName=Trim(Rs("AuditUserName"))
cAuditDate= Trim(Rs("fdtmAuditDate"))
cLastModifyUserID= Trim(Rs("fchrLastModifyUserID"))
cLastModifyUserName= Trim(Rs("LastModifyUserName"))
cLastModifyDate= Trim(Rs("fchrLastModifyDate"))
cTestDate= Trim(Rs("fdtmTestDate"))
cTestCount= Trim(Rs("fintTestCount"))
cTestState= Trim(Rs("ftinTestState"))
cPathNO= Trim(Rs("fchrPathNO"))
cVersion= Trim(Rs("fchrVersion"))
cVersionState= Trim(Rs("ftinVersionState"))
cVersionSourceID= Trim(Rs("fchrVersionSourceID"))
cVersionSourceName = Trim(Rs("VersionSourceName"))
cNoUsed= Trim(Rs("fbitNoUsed"))
cDetailDesc= Trim(Rs("fchrDetailDesc"))
cSearchKey= Trim(Rs("fchrSearchKey"))
cTreeNodeID= Trim(Rs("fchrTreeNodeID"))
cResult=Trim(Rs("fchrResult"))
cDealPriorityID=Replace(cDealPriorityID,"-","_")
cDealPriorityID=Mid(cDealPriorityID,2,Len(cDealPriorityID)-2)
cTestProgressID=Replace(cTestProgressID,"-","_")
cTestProgressID=Mid(cTestProgressID,2,Len(cTestProgressID)-2)
End If
Set Rs = Nothing
if len(cTreeNodeID)>0 then
cTreeNodeID=Replace(cTreeNodeID,"-","_")
cTreeNodeID=Mid(cTreeNodeID,2,Len(cTreeNodeID) - 2)
else
cTreeNodeID="ROOT"
cTreeNodeName ="测试用例分类"
end if
%>
<body topmargin=12 onunload="Check_Close()" onunload="Check_Close()" onload="SetCreateDate()">
<table cellpadding="0" cellspacing="0" border="0" align="center" WIDTH="90%">
<tr>
<td width="50%" nowrap>用例编号 <input type=text size=20 maxlength=50 class=InputText id=TUCCode onchange="Javascript:BSubmit.disabled = false" value="<%=cCaseMainCode%>" disabled></td>
<td width="50%" nowrap> 所属分类 <input type=text id=TreeNodeName size=20 maxlength=50 class=InputText disabled value="<%=cTreeNodeName%>"></td>
</tr>
<tr>
<td width="50%" nowrap>用例名称 <input type=text size=20 maxlength=15 class=InputText id=TUCName onkeyup="TUCCode_OnFocus()" onchange="Javascript:BSubmit.disabled = false" value="<%=cCaseName%>"></td>
<td width="50%" nowrap> 检索键值 <input type=text size=20 maxlength=15 class=InputText id=SearchKey onchange="Javascript:BSubmit.disabled = false" value="<%=cSearchKey%>"></td>
</tr></table>
<table cellpadding="0" cellspacing="0" border="0" align="center" WIDTH="90%">
<tr>
<td width="50%" nowrap>测试阶段 <select id=TestProgressID size=1><%
MySql = "Select REPLACE(REPLACE(REPLACE(fchrTestProgressID , '}', ''), '{', ''), '-', '_') As TestProgressID ,fchrTestProgressName as TestProgressName From Sys_testProgress Order By TestProgressName "
Set Rs = Conn.Execute(MySql)
While NOT Rs.EOF
Response.Write "<option value='"+Trim(Rs("TestProgressID"))+"'"
If Rs("TestProgressID") = cTestProgressID Then
Response.Write " selected "
End If
Response.Write ">"+Trim(Rs("TestProgressName"))+"</option>"
Rs.MoveNext
Wend
Set Rs = Nothing
%></Select></td>
<td width="50%" nowrap> 优先级别 <select id=DealPriorityID size=1><%
MySql = "Select REPLACE(REPLACE(REPLACE(fchrDealPriority , '}', ''), '{', ''), '-', '_') As DealPriorityID,fchrDealPriorityName as DealPriorityName From Sys_DealPriority Order By fchrDealPriorityName"
Set Rs = Conn.Execute(MySql)
While NOT Rs.EOF
Response.Write "<option value='"+Trim(Rs("DealPriorityID"))+"'"
If Rs("DealPriorityID") = cDealPriorityID Then
Response.Write " selected "
End If
Response.Write ">"+Trim(Rs("DealPriorityName"))+"</option>"
Rs.MoveNext
Wend
Set Rs = Nothing
%></Select></td>
</tr>
<tr>
<td width="50%" nowrap>测试类别 <select id=TestTypeID size=1><%
MySql = "Select REPLACE(REPLACE(REPLACE(fchrTestTypeID , '}', ''), '{', ''), '-', '_') As TestTypeID,fchrTestTypeName as TestTypeName From Sys_TestType Order by TestTypeName "
Set Rs = Conn.Execute(MySql)
While NOT Rs.EOF
Response.Write "<option value='"+Trim(Rs("TestTypeID"))+"'"
If Rs("TestTypeID") = cTestTypeID Then
Response.Write " selected "
End If
Response.Write ">"+Trim(Rs("TestTypeName"))+"</option>"
Rs.MoveNext
Wend
Set Rs = Nothing
%></Select></td>
<td width="50%" nowrap> 审核状态 <Select type=InputText id=AuditSate onchange="Javascript:BSubmit.disabled = false">
<option value="0" <% If cAuditState=0 then Response.Write "Selected" End If %>>未审核</option>
<option value="1" <% If cAuditState=1 then Response.Write "Selected" End If %>>审核通过</option>
<option value="2" <% If cAuditState=2 then Response.Write "Selected" End If %>>审核拒绝</option>
</Select></td>
</tr>
<tr>
<td width="50%" nowrap>用例版本 <input type=text size=20 class=InputText id=Version onchange="Javascript:BSubmit.disabled = false" value="<%=cVersion %>"></td>
<td width="50%" nowrap> 版本状态 <Select type=InputText id=VersionState onchange="Javascript:BSubmit.disabled = false">
<option value="0" <% If cVersionState=0 then Response.Write "Selected" End If %>>原始用例</option>
<option value="1" <% If cVersionState=1 then Response.Write "Selected" End If %>>临时用例</option>
<option value="2" <% If cVersionState=2 then Response.Write "Selected" End If %>>版本用例</option>
</Select></td>
</tr>
<tr>
<td width="50%" nowrap>补丁编号 <input type=text size=20 maxlength=10 class=InputText id=PathNo onchange="Javascript:BSubmit.disabled = false" value="<%=cPathNo%>"></td>
<td width="50%" nowrap> 所属项目 <input type=text id=ItsProject size=20 maxlength=50 class=InputText disabled value="<%=cItsProject%>"></td>
</tr>
</table>
<table cellpadding="0" cellspacing="0" border="0" align="center" WIDTH="90%">
<tr>
<td width="100%" nowrap>产品路径 <input type=text size=58 maxlength=100 class=InputText id=ItsProductPath disabled onchange="Javascript:BSubmit.disabled = false" value="<%=cItsProductPath%>"></td>
</tr>
<tr>
<td width="100%" nowrap>用例摘要 <input type=text size=58 maxlength=100 class=InputText id=TUCDesc onchange="Javascript:BSubmit.disabled = false" value="<%=cTestDesc%>"></td>
</tr>
<tr>
<td width="100%" nowrap>关联文件 <input type=text size=58 maxlength=100 class=InputText id=FileURL onchange="Javascript:BSubmit.disabled = false" value="<%=cFileURL%>"></td>
</tr>
<tr>
<td width="100%" nowrap>关联脚本 <input type=text size=58 maxlength=100 class=InputText id=ScriptURL onchange="Javascript:BSubmit.disabled = false" value="<%=cScriptURL%>"></td>
</tr>
<tr>
<td width="100%" nowrap>原始用例 <input type=text size=43 maxlength=100 class=InputText id=VersionSourceName onchange="Javascript:BSubmit.disabled = false" value="<%=cVersionSourceName%>" disabled>
<input type="button" value="浏览..." name="select" style="background-color: #e6e6e6; color: #000000"
language="vbscript" onmousedown="
cTemp = showModalDialog("STestUC.asp","选择用例名称","dialogHeight:12;dialogWidth:14;help:no;resizable:no;status:no")
if cTemp<>'Exit' then
cTmp=Split(cTemp,"/")
VersionSourceID.value=cTmp(0)
PYCode.value=cTmp(1)
cTm=Split(cTmp(2),"")
VersionSourceName.value=cTm(0)
else
VersionSourceID.value=""
VersionSourceName.value=""
end if
"
>
</td>
</tr>
</table>
<table cellpadding="0" cellspacing="0" border="0" align="center" WIDTH="90%">
<tr>
<td>测试描述<br> <textarea id=DetailDesc cols=56 rows=5 onchange="Javascript:BSubmit.disabled = false"><%=cDetailDesc %></textarea>
</td>
</tr>
<tr>
<td>预期结果<br> <textarea id=Result cols=56 rows=5 onchange="Javascript:BSubmit.disabled = false"><%=cResult%></textarea>
</td>
</tr>
<tr>
<td width="100%"nowrap >补充说明<br> <textarea id=Entironment cols=56 rows=3 onchange="Javascript:BSubmit.disabled = false" ><%=cEntironment%></textarea></td>
</tr>
</table>
<table cellpadding="0" cellspacing="0" border="0" align="center" WIDTH="90%">
<tr>
<td width="50%" nowrap>创建人员 <input type=text size=20 maxlength=50 class=InputText id=CreateUserName onchange="Javascript:BSubmit.disabled = false" disabled value="<%=cCreateUserName%>"></td>
<td width="50%" nowrap> 创建日期 <input type=text size=20 maxlength=15 class=InputText id=CreateDate onchange="Javascript:BSubmit.disabled = false" disabled value="<%=cCreatedate%>"></td>
</tr>
<tr>
<td width="50%" nowrap>审核人员 <input type=text size=20 maxlength=15 class=InputText id=AuditUserName onchange="Javascript:BSubmit.disabled = false" disabled value="<%=cAuditUserName%>"></td>
<td width="50%" nowrap> 审核日期 <input type=text size=20 maxlength=15 class=InputText id=AuditDate onchange="Javascript:BSubmit.disabled = false" disabled value="<%=cAuditDate%>"></td>
</tr></table>
<div align=right> <input type=button value=确定 disabled id=BSubmit class=Button Onclick="Submit()"> <input type=button id=BCancel value=取消 class=Button Onclick="Cancel()"> <input type=button value=删除 <%If Application("SysReady") Then Response.Write "disabled" End If%> class=Button Onclick="Delete()"> </div>
<Input Type=Hidden id=CreateUserID Value="<%=cCreateUserID%>">
<Input Type=Hidden id=VersionSourceID Value="<%=cVersionSourceID%>">
<Input Type=Hidden id=AuditUserID Value="<%=cAuditUserID%>">
<Input Type=Hidden id=LastModifyUserID Value="<%=cLastModifyUserID%>">
<Input Type=Hidden id=CaseMainID Value="<%=cCaseMainID%>">
<Input Type=Hidden id=TreeNodeID Value="<%=cTreeNodeID%>">
<Input Type=Hidden id=CaseMainID_A Value="<%=cCaseMainID_A%>">
<Input Type=Hidden id=CodePref Value="">
<Input Type=Hidden id=PYCode Value="">
</body>
</html>
<%
If Err.description = "缺少对象" Or Err.description = "" Then
%>
<%
Else
cTemp = Replace(Err.description,chr(13),"\n")
%>
<Script Lang=javascript>
<!--
alert("操作失败,原因为:"+"<%=cTemp%>"+" 请联系系统管理员");
window.close();
-->
</Script>
<%
End If
%>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-